Compensation

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Production Management Consultant in Cary, NC, USA is $78,000 to $115,000 per year. This salary range can vary depending on the industry, company, and level of experience. Some factors that may affect the salary range include the size of the company, the complexity of the production processes, and the consultant's specific skills and qualifications.

About MetLife

MetLife, Inc. provides insurance and financial services to individual and institutional customers. It offers life insurance, annuities, automobile and homeowner's insurance and retail banking services to individuals as well as group insurance, reinsurance and retirement and savings products and services. The company operates its business through six segments: Retail, Group, Voluntary and Worksite Benefits, Corporate Benefit Funding, Latin America, Asia, and Europe, the Middle East and Africa.
